When a vehicle is driven in a straight line, the wheels on the left side of the vehicle should be parallel with the wheels on the right. If one wheel is slightly off this axis, the vehicle may want to pull, or drift, to that side.
Manufacturers have wheel alignment specifications for each make and model of vehicle. Wheel alignment checks are carried out by garages that specialize in tire sales and repair.
Wheel alignment equipment checks a vehicle's suspension and steering angles to make sure they are properly adjusted. Suspension and steering components that are even slightly out of adjustment can cause tire wear.
About this Repair: Wheel Alignment
Why this happens
An alignment may be needed if the vehicle does not drive in a straight line when the steering wheel is held straight.
If the vehicle is out of alignment, it may feel unsteady at highway speeds and may have a tendency to pull to one side when driving in a straight line.
